Common Challenges and Solutions in Network Management


Network management is a critical aspect of maintaining a smooth and efficient operation of any organization’s IT infrastructure. However, managing networks can be a complex and challenging task, as there are various issues that can arise. In this article, we will discuss some common challenges in network management and provide solutions to help overcome them.

1. Network Security

One of the most pressing challenges in network management is ensuring the security of the network. With the increasing number of cyber threats and attacks, organizations need to implement robust security measures to protect their data and prevent unauthorized access. To address this challenge, organizations can implement firewalls, intrusion detection systems, encryption, and regular security audits to identify and fix vulnerabilities.

2. Network Performance

Another common challenge in network management is ensuring optimal network performance. Slow network speeds, downtime, and bottlenecks can impact productivity and hinder the organization’s operations. To improve network performance, organizations can invest in high-quality networking equipment, regularly monitor and analyze network traffic, and optimize network configuration settings.

3. Network Scalability

As organizations grow and expand, their network infrastructure needs to scale accordingly to accommodate the increasing number of users and devices. Network scalability is a significant challenge for many organizations, as they need to ensure that their network can handle the increased workload without compromising performance. To address this challenge, organizations can implement virtualization technologies, cloud-based solutions, and scalable network architecture designs.

4. Network Monitoring and Management

Effective network monitoring and management are essential for identifying and resolving issues quickly. However, managing a large network with multiple devices and components can be overwhelming. To streamline network monitoring and management, organizations can use network management tools and software that provide real-time monitoring, alerting, and reporting capabilities. Additionally, organizations can implement automation and centralized management solutions to simplify network management tasks.

5. Compliance and Regulations

Compliance with industry regulations and data protection laws is another challenge in network management. Organizations need to ensure that their network infrastructure meets the necessary compliance requirements to avoid legal consequences and data breaches. To address this challenge, organizations can conduct regular compliance audits, implement security policies and procedures, and educate employees on data protection best practices.
